1 dead, 13 buses, properties worth millions burnt in Onitsha inferno

At least no fewer than one person, thirteen buses and shops including houses worth millions went up in flames when a tanker fully loaded with premium motor spirits fell and exploded.

The tragedy which rendered properties worth millions useless, took place at Ogidi around the popular International Building Materials market, Onitsha, at about 5pm Sunday evening.

News Echo gathered that the fire emanated from a fallen tanker conveying inflammable content which fell into a drainage and sparked fire after spilling its content.

One of the residents of the area who spoke to our correspondent on phone said the tanker was stationary when another articulated vehicle trailer rammed into it, following loss of control.

He said, “Several luxury buses parked around the area immediately went up in flames. Shops and buildings within the area were also not left out. The fire was too much that it was difficult for fire service officers to battle.”

Another eyewitness, simply identified as Emeka noted that the fire could have escalated to other parts of the area if not for the quick arrival of his men and assistance from other stations, including the one inside the market.

“The buses and shops affected in the incident where those within the area. I don’t know the number of dead persons but I think the arrival of fire service in time also helped to quench the fire”.

Anambra Police spokesman, DSP Tochukwu Ikenga while confirming the incident, said it’s unfortunate that one life was lost. He however assured that the police personnel have cordoned off the area and with the assistance of fire service departments, the situation has been brought under control.
